MEBENDAZOLE

Molecular Formula C16H13N303
Molecular Weight 295.30
Chemical Name Carbamic acid, (5-benzoyl-1-H-benzimidazol-2-yl),
Methyl ester methyl 5-benzoyl-2-benzimidazolecarbamate
Common Name Mebendazole
CAS No. 31431-39-7
Therapeutic Category(Vet) Anthelmintics
SPECIFICATIONS:
Description White to slightly yellow amorphous powder, almost odourless
Solubility Insoluble in water and in most of the organic solvents. Freely soluble in Formic Acid.
Identification (IR) Complies as per USP
Heavy Metals Not more than 0.002%
Sulphated ash Not more than 0.1%
Loss On Drying Not more than 0.5
Assay(On Dried Basis) Not less than 98% and not more than 102%
Pharmacopoeial Standards U.S.P. 23
Packing 25/50 kgs Drums
